Start corrals are designated start areas designed to facilitate a more efficient and convenient race start for all runners. Wave 1 start corrals are assigned based on a participant's accepted qualifying time. Wave 2 and Wave 3 start corrals are assigned based on a runner's expected finish time.
The New York City Marathon does NOT disqualify participants for walking. It's quite common to see runners following a run-walk strategy. Sweep buses will follow the marathon route at a 6 1/2-hour marathon pace, roughly 15 minutes per mile/6.4 kilometers per hour after the final wave start.
There are three starts (green, orange, blue) in each of five waves; each wave has six corrals. Your start color, wave, and corral are indicated in your confirmation form and on your race number (bib).
If you are unable to visit the Pre-Party you can have somebody act as your proxy to collect your race bib from the Pre-Party. In order to pick up your race bib, you will need to present the following: A government-issued photo identification, such as a driver's licence or passport.
Runners may move back to a slower corral but may not move forward to a faster corral. Any participant who climbs over a barricade or otherwise enters improperly may be disqualified. For participant safety, once a corral is closed for entry, late-arriving participants must report to the last corral.
The following items are prohibited from all NYRR events and race venues: Camelbaks® and any type of hydration backpack/vest (Fuel belts and hand-held water bottles are allowed, but nothing that is worn over the shoulders.)

NYC Marathon corrals are designated sections at the starting line of the New York City Marathon that group runners based on their expected race pace. This system helps to streamline the start of the race and ensure that runners start at a pace that matches their abilities.
All participants in the NYC Marathon are required to indicate their expected finish times during registration to be placed in appropriate corrals.
When registering for the NYC Marathon, participants are typically asked to provide their recent race times or expected finish times, which will determine their placement in the corrals.
The purpose of NYC Marathon corrals is to manage the flow of runners at the start of the race, minimize congestion, and enhance the overall running experience by ensuring that runners start with others at a similar pace.
Runners must report their expected finish times and any recent race performances to help race organizers place them in the appropriate corrals.
